I was at work using my hcigar Nemesis Clone and my button was acting weird.

I took a look at my button and it appears that while taking it apart I either lost the battery pin lock or didn't have it. I spent over an hour searching for this work, with no results : (. I will attach a picture so that you can see what I am talking about. I haven't been home to check the box to see if there was another one supplied but I doubt it. I was just wondering if anyone else has lost this little pin or came up with any solution on how to fix this. The neme is still usable the button just spins and the locking ring will not stay tight on there because the button is now locked down.

Has anyone had this issue, found where to get another, or how to fix it?

I just bought this neme clone about a week ago so I'd really like to get this taken care of.

Coming from a fellow Nemmy clone owner, I'd venture to guess the weedeater stuff may just work better than the steel pin. That little steel pin is what causes all of the binding to begin with, it sucks! Terrible design. The plastic would probably offer less sliding resistance than that pin, which digs itself into the brass threading. That is the notchyness you feel while pressing in.
